HAWAII STATUTES AND CODES

§143-2 - License required.

     §143-2  License required.  It shall be unlawful for any person to own or harbor a dog unless the dog is licensed as provided by this chapter, provided that the legislative bodies of the several counties may, by ordinance, dispense with or modify the licensing requirements of this chapter.  This chapter shall not apply to dogs under the age of three months which do not run at large, dogs in quarantine and dogs brought into the State exclusively for the purpose of entering them in a dog show or dog exhibition and not allowed to run at large. [L 1941, c 268, §2; RL 1945, §7152; RL 1955, §156-2; HRS §143-2; am L 1973, c 146, §1]
